    This was a smaller children's museum than I expected and is more like a play area similar to Play Street Museum in St. Charles, MO. It's located between some restaurants on a shopping strip. I like that admission for adults accompanying kids is only $4 on Thursdays. Weekend admissions cost a little more. My kids played with pretty much everything within 1.5 hours including the art room (small paper craft, Lego table, and painting on the windows), light room, fire station, cafe, vet clinic, grocery store, puppet theater, water table. They have several climbing structures, shopping carts to run over your feet as kids race around the track, and little cars. They have a party room available for private birthday parties too. Overall it's an excellent place for pretend/imaginative play and water play (bring extra clothes). The space is limited; otherwise it would be neat if they rotated or brought in new exhibits sometimes or expanded the art room activities.

    This place is incredible! I was so impressed! Price is $11 per child + $4 per adult, so $15 for my four year old daughter to play all day and she loved it! There are a lot of imaginative play options, something that she really loves but there are also more active, hands on things as well like climbers and building toys. Fans of Melissa and Doug will certainly appreciate this play place. They even have a little shop with one of the largest selections of Melissa and Doug toys, among others, that I've seen. I was a bit worried about cleanliness/germs before coming but I got over it quickly since this place gives off clean vibes as soon as you enter. There's a hand washing station where everyone has to wash up before entering and the place is spotless! It felt cleaner than wal-mart or a public park that's for sure. There are three family sized restrooms and a separate nursing room with a table/toys for older kids to sit and play while waiting. There are also plenty of seats/benches located throughout for adults to sit which was really great because I could let my daughter play without hovering but I was able to comfortably keep an eye on her no matter where she went to play. They had a constant good mix of Disney classics/tv show tunes/kids pop playing at a good level the whole time too, so ambiance is just awesome. There's an awesome water feature as well. I recommend having a change of clothes and sandals if you plan on letting little ones play here and saving it for last if you have other errands to run, or if it's cold out, as even though they had water smocks my daughter was able to soak herself, but she had so much fun, so it's definitely worth it.
